What Trump, Johnson Want From U.S.-U.K. Trade Deal

The unconventional leaders of the U.S. and the U.K. have both made big promises about a post-Brexit trade deal between their nations. Securing a pact won’t be easy. The two sides disagree on issues ranging from chicken to 5G. Plus, President Donald Trump is seeking re-election in November (meaning negotiations might finish under a different U.S. administration), and the U.K. can’t finalize a comprehensive deal with the U.S. until it figures out its post-divorce relationship with the EU.
